Video: Kas ir MySQL trigeris?
2024 Autors: Lynn Donovan | [email protected]. Pēdējoreiz modificēts: 2023-12-15 23:50
The MySQL trigeris ir datu bāzes objekts, kas ir saistīts ar tabulu. Tas tiks aktivizēts, kad tabulai tiks izpildīta noteikta darbība. The sprūda var izpildīt, palaižot kādu no tālāk norādītajām darbībām MySQL paziņojumi uz tabulas: INSERT, UPDATE un DELETE, un to var izsaukt pirms vai pēc notikuma.
Tādā veidā, kas ir aktivizētājs MySQL ar piemēru?
Programmā MySQL trigeris ir saglabāta programma, kas tiek automātiski izsaukta, reaģējot uz notikumu, piemēram, ievietot , Atjaunināt , vai dzēst kas notiek saistītajā tabula . Piemēram, varat definēt trigeri, kas tiek izsaukts automātiski, pirms tiek ievietota jauna rinda a tabula.
kā palaist trigeri MySQL? Pamata sprūda sintakse ir: CREATE TRIGERIS `notikuma_nosaukums` PIRMS/PĒC IEVIEŠANAS/ATJAUNINĀŠANAS/DZĒSŠANAS datu bāzē. `tabula` KATRAS RINDAS SĀKUMAM - sprūda body -- šis kods tiek lietots katrai -- ievietotajai/atjauninātajai/dzēstajai rindai END; Mums ir nepieciešami divi trigeri - PĒC IEVADĪŠANAS un PĒC ATJAUNINĀŠANAS emuāra tabulā.
Ziniet arī, kas ir sprūda un kāds ir tā mērķis, sniedziet piemēru?
Sprūda : A sprūda ir datubāzē saglabāta procedūra, kas automātiski izsauc ikreiz, kad datu bāzē notiek īpašs notikums. Priekš piemērs , a sprūda var izsaukt, kad noteiktā tabulā tiek ievietota rinda vai tiek atjauninātas noteiktas tabulas kolonnas.
Kas ir aktivizētājs programmā MySQL w3schools?
A sprūda ir darbību kopa, kas tiek izpildīta automātiski, kad norādītajā tabulā tiek veikta noteikta izmaiņu darbība (SQL INSERT, UPDATE vai DELETE priekšraksts). Trigeri ir noderīgi tādiem uzdevumiem kā biznesa noteikumu izpilde, ievades datu validācija un audita izsekojamība. Saturs: lietojums trigeri.
Ieteicams:
KAS IR SET datu tips MySQL?
MySQL SET datu tips. SET datu tips ir virknes tips, taču to bieži dēvē par sarežģītu tipu, jo to ieviešana ir sarežģīta. SET datu tips var saturēt neierobežotu skaitu virkņu no iepriekš definēta virkņu saraksta, kas norādīts tabulas izveides laikā
Kas paliek MySQL?
LEFT() funkcija MySQL LEFT() atgriež noteiktu rakstzīmju skaitu no virknes kreisās puses. Gan skaitlis, gan virkne tiek piegādāti kā funkcijas argumenti
Kā atļaut MySQL klientam izveidot savienojumu ar attālo mysql?
Veiciet šādas darbības, lai piešķirtu lietotājam piekļuvi no attālā resursdatora: Piesakieties savā MySQL serverī lokāli kā root lietotājs, izmantojot šādu komandu: # mysql -u root -p. Jums tiek prasīts ievadīt MySQL root paroli. Izmantojiet komandu GRANT šādā formātā, lai attālajam lietotājam iespējotu piekļuvi
Kāda ir atšķirība starp MySQL un mysql?
MySQL ir RDBMS, kas ļauj sakārtot datubāzē esošos datus. MySQL nodrošina vairāku lietotāju piekļuvi datu bāzēm. Šī RDBMS sistēma tiek izmantota kopā ar PHP un Apache Web Server kombināciju papildus Linux izplatīšanai. MySQL izmanto SQL valodu, lai vaicātu datu bāzē
Kāda ir atšķirība starp MySQL un mysql serveri?
Varat izmantot mysql klientu, lai nosūtītu komandas uz jebkuru mysql serveri; attālajā datorā vai savā. Themysql serveris tiek izmantots, lai saglabātu datus un nodrošinātu tiem vaicājuma interfeisu (SQL). Mysql-servera pakotne ļauj palaist MySQL serveri, kas var mitināt vairākas datu bāzes un apstrādāt vaicājumus šajās datu bāzēs